
Is Europe Ready for Possible Return of President Trump?
Voice of America
FILE — French President Emmanuel Macron, left, walks with former U.S. President Donald Trump at NATO headquarters in Brussels, July 11, 2018. During a town hall meeting last week, Trump refused to commit to U.S. membership of NATO if elected to a second term.
America's allies in Europe are debating how to prepare for a possible second term for Donald Trump in the White House after he secured a record win at Monday's Iowa Republican caucuses, cementing his place as front-runner to take on Joe Biden in November's election.
